Specifies safety and performance requirements for manually powered medical suction equipment meant for oro pharyngeal suction to establish and maintain the patency of the airway. Covers equipment operated by hand or by foot or both. Also covers non-electrical suction equipment that may be integrated with electrical equipment. Does not apply to electrically powered suction equipment, whether battery powered or mains electricity. Coverage includes definitions, marking, resistance to environment and design requirements. Includes annexes and diagrams. BS AMD 9350 RENUMBERS THIS STANDARD
